Al Merrick Flyer Good For Beginner Shortboarder?

PostPosted: Tue Jun 06, 2006 4:59 am
by oceangrrl
I've been surfing a 7'6" mini mal for about 1.5 years now and I think i've nailed down the basics.. I can pop up swiftly (without the knee), bottom turns, and I can ride along side the face of a wave nicely...

Now I'm thinking about transitioning to a shortboard. My friend suggested an Al Merrick Flyer since it's good for small surf (small as in 3ft. - 6 ft) and I spend a good deal of time in small surf. So I'm wondering if an Al Merrick Flyer is good for a first time shortboarder and what size i should get

i started surfing 6 months ago and i recently moved from a 9' foam longboard to a surftech merrick flyer II 7'. it's a bit wobbly, but very rideable even in small surf and i dig it!
